[QUOTE="dir, post: 194668, member: 24485"] I'm using RC3 and 1.2.9.34282. I deleted my database and all files in the thumbs subdirectory and re-ran the importer. Provided I don't choose to skip a series or permanently ignore (which crashes it), and provided the internet connection doesn't lose a packet or something (which causes a timeout and halts the import), it finds all episodes. Because my actual videos are on a network connection I have "Keep reference to files..." ticked under Online Data Sync and "AUtomatically Choose series" ticked (which doesn't really work for about 12 out of 100 series). It's great and leaves me with only a few suggestions: - allow for manually specifying the banner to use (via file browser) - strip out special characters from series names before doing comparisons (like colons and question marks) - if the series name exactly matches one of the retrieved searches, then pick it automatically even if more than one came back (choose the EXACT one, stripped of special characters of course) - add an "OK" or "Close" button to the configuration screen so I don't grimmace every time I spend 2 hours updating things and only have an "X" button to close the window down with (which classically means "abort what I was doing and kill this thing" in standard Windows user terms - make the log window cut and pastable (well, copyable anyway)! love it, need it, will donate to it!
